Output 81ff54c626bddb559679223754f10052ac4ab2af9df16042a88f88e044d01f52:1

value
5858916463
script pubkey
OP_0 OP_PUSHBYTES_20 13a14247329c2b473061dec961f0d345e3246912
address
tb1qzws5y3ejns45wvrpmmykruxngh3jg6gjg6zz9d
transaction
81ff54c626bddb559679223754f10052ac4ab2af9df16042a88f88e044d01f52